Philip Togni, Tanbark Hill Vineyard Cabernet Sauvignon other_regions_italy This could therefore be consideredThe medium to full bodied 2021 Cabernet Sauvignon Tanbark Hill Vineyard delivers complex notes of mountain fruit, with hints of sage and bay leaf accenting cassis, blueberries and raspberries. In the mouth, it's firmly buttressed by grainy tannins, with terrific acids that linger on the finish in mouthwatering fashion. This, Togni's "early drinking" wine, should age two decades with ease.
